Part 3
Cylindrical Soil Sample
a) The cylindrical soil sample begins at stress state where v=h=60kPa. Plot the point associated with the stress state on a p-q stress path. Then, the vertical stress is increased while the horizontal stress remains at 60kPa. The soil reaches a failure state when k=hv=0.25.
Plot the point on the stress path where soil reaches failure, and connect the initial to failure points with a line representing the intermediate stress states. Identify the coordinates of the initial and failure states.
